Posted by cleo (Member # 6646) on :
 
I am thinking of trying this to combat depression. I would like to know if anyone has experience taking it. Did it work ? Did it cause a flare? Wierd symptoms? How much to take? What brand is best? I have read that it has other beneficial properties, did anyone have any positive changes and how long before they noticed.
 
Posted by 17hens (Member # 23747) on :
 
I've been taking it for about 3 years. I love it and recommend it to many people. My cousin, my sister-in-law, and two of my good friends are all taking it now and they love it too.

I take Nature Made SAM-e and take 400 mg. first thing in the morning.

When I started taking it, I took 200 mg. for the first week and felt very tired by noon and took a few naps that week. The next week I hopped up to 400 mg. and felt great from the get go.

The way i understand it, SAM-e helps the body absorb vit. B, which is a mood stabilizer and raises you energy, so I take a B Complex supplement too.

I have a book, "SAM-e" by Richard Brown, MD, that I found very helpful in the beginning and answered many of my questions. If you have any questions, please let me know and I'll gladly look them up.

Posted by LAXlover (Member # 25518) on :
 
I just started taking this also. It is one of the supps that Dr. Burr. lists in his protocol. He says to help with neurological symptoms, take SAM-e in conjuction with Acetyl-L-Carnitine. He suggests 1500-2000 mg ALC and 400 mg SAM-e per day on empty stomach.
